Permit takeaway

Lewiston says a fence permit is required and the department needs the proposed fence length and height when the permit is requested.

Zoning and placement

Fence placement may be on the property line, but Lewiston recommends offsetting the fence enough to maintain both sides without crossing onto a neighbor's property.

Building and trade review

New accessory dwelling units may be constructed with a building permit and are limited by the city's ADU standards, including maximum size and owner-occupancy rules.

Call before applying when

Call before applying if the fence will be on a property line, the property is historic or constrained, the ADU is detached, the ADU approaches 900 square feet, or owner-occupancy status is unclear.
